this is quite an old issue, but Sebastian's suggestion is exactly what I'd urgently need;
I desperately searched for such a functionality in the docu (already two years ago and now again), but found nothing.

Can anybody tell me how to change the text in the title bar from "MPlayer" to some other text?
Even "MPlayer 1" or "MPlayer 2"  (etc.) would do.
I have several MPlayers running at same time, showing similar movies, so they are hard to distinguish (but it is important to distinguish them).
There would be the possibility to distinguish the MPlayer windows by giving them different positions (using the "geometry" option),
but a distinguishable window title would be much safer and better.

Currently, I am using the Mplayer 1.0rc2-3.3.5 on Linux.
Sorry, I am probably none of those who are able to download and patch the sources as described previously in this thread.
Also, the title text I need is not stored within the movie - it can only be passed from outside.
